📝 Ingredients
Organic Stone Ground Yellow Corn, Organic Expeller Pressed Oil (organic Sunflower Seed, Organic Safflower Seed, And/or Organic Canola), Sea Salt.

💬 Nutrition Q&A: Yellow Corn Organic Tortilla Rounds
Is Yellow Corn Organic Tortilla Rounds good for weight loss?
These tortillas are calorie-dense at 150 calories per ounce, so portion control matters if you're watching your weight. They could fit into a weight loss plan in reasonable amounts, especially paired with protein and vegetables to increase satiety.
Is Yellow Corn Organic Tortilla Rounds a good snack for kids?
These work well for kids as a familiar, versatile base for meals. The mild corn flavor and soft texture are generally appealing, though younger children may need help handling them.
Is Yellow Corn Organic Tortilla Rounds gluten-free?
Yes, these are gluten-free—they're made from corn with no gluten-containing ingredients listed.
What diets does Yellow Corn Organic Tortilla Rounds suit?
Suitable for gluten-free, vegan, and vegetarian diets. The organic ingredients and minimal processing also appeal to those prioritizing whole foods.
What does Yellow Corn Organic Tortilla Rounds pair well with for a balanced meal?
Pair with beans or lean proteins like chicken or fish, plus plenty of vegetables, to create a balanced meal. Adding avocado or Greek yogurt boosts the nutrition and helps balance the carbs with healthy fats and protein.
